U.S. Air Force Airman 1st Class Nathan Raybon, 374th Logistics Readiness Squadron fuels distribution technician, prepares fuel support equipment during exercise Beverly Morning 26-1 at Yokota Air Base, Japan, Oct. 16, 2025. Beverly Morning is a base readiness exercise series designed to sharpen Yokota Air Base’s ability to maneuver and sustain the joint force. Through routine training, personnel at Yokota Air Base remain postured to rapidly respond to any potential real-world crises and maintain its status as the premier hub for power projection in the Indo-Pacific theater.
